Human Resources Generalist

Rocket
Detroit, MI

The Human Resources Generalist, GANNG leads and supports the company’s people function, including employee relations, recruiting support, onboarding, payroll coordination, benefits administration, HRIS management, performance management, compliance, and people-related policies. This role serves as a trusted resource for team members and leaders, providing practical guidance, sound judgment, and consistent support. The Human Resources Generalist, GANNG works closely with leadership, finance, benefit providers, payroll providers, and legal counsel to ensure the company’s people’s practices are organized, compliant, and aligned with business goals and company culture.

About the role

  • Advise and support all team members and leaders on team relations related issues by answering questions, giving directions, escalating issues, and offering solutions as appropriate on human resources (HR) issues

  • Serve as a generalist for all HR needs, including recruiting, leadership development and education, payroll, compensation, HRIS and benefits by answering questions and escalating issues as appropriate

  • Manage the employee lifecycle, including job postings, recruiting coordination, offer letters, onboarding, employment changes, personnel files, offboarding, and exit interviews

  • Manage team member benefits, perks, and people policies and ensure they provide the most value to team members

  • Collaborate and liaise with teams from our various benefit providers as subject matter experts on overall team member experience and brainstorm solutions

  • Collaborate with the Legal team to ensure compliance and mitigation of business risk by advising leaders and team members on applicable employment laws

  • Manage team member data to identify and summarize trends (e.g., exit interviews, turnover, overtime)

  • Collaborate with Senior Leadership to set team/people goals and objectives

  • Act as an objective, neutral advocate who seeks to understand, investigate and make unbiased recommendations for all sides: the company, team members and leaders

  • Assist all team members in finding solutions for individual team member challenges (e.g., personal challenges, conflict resolution, etc.)

  • Guide leaders through the effective management of team member performance

About you

Minimum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in business, human resources, or related field

  • 3 years of experience in human resources, team relations, or related field

  • Working knowledge of employment laws, HR compliance practices, and employee relations best practices

  • Experience handling confidential and sensitive employee matters

  • Experience with HRIS, payroll, benefits, or employee data systems

  • Strong communication, judgment, documentation, organization, and problem-solving skills

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ience in a growing, creative, professional services, or project-based company environment

  • Experience implementing or administering HRIS, payroll, performance management, recruiting, onboarding, or benefits systems

  • SHRM-CP, SHRM-SCP, PHR, or SPHR certification
